  Guar Gum Powder
 
 
 
 
  Product
 
 
 
 
 
  • It is soluble in hot and cold water but insoluble in most organic solvents.
  • It is non-ionic and maintains a constant high viscosity over a broad range of pH.
  • The viscosity of its solution increases gradually with increasing concentration of guar gum in water.
  • Temperature, pH, presence of salts and other solids influence the viscosity of guar gum solution.
  • Guar gum forms highly viscous colloidal dispersions when hydrated in cold water. The time required for complete hydration in water and to achieve maximum viscosity depend on various factors, i.e., the pH, temperature, grade of powder used and equipment.
  • Guar gum is compatible with a variety of inorganic and organic substances including certain dyes and various constituents of food.
  • Guar gum has excellent thickening, emulsifying, stabilizing and film forming properties. So, it is known as one of the best thickening additives, emulsifying additives and stabilizing additives.
  • At very low concentration, guar gum has excellent settling (flocculation) properties and it acts as a filter aid.
  • Guar gum powder has strong hydrogen bonding properties.

The extracts of guar consists of Guar Gum = 28%

Churi and Korma = 67%

Extracts depends on the quality of Guar seeds.
